    Congrats Hickory! I'm certainly glad we had a good judge over one who chooses bases on popularity. Sometimes a dog who fits the standard the most amazingly is there, but the judge chooses the crowd favorite.

    Its not that hard to get all those standards in your head. I've been obsessed with dogs since I was a kid. Its all in me noggin I tells you. I even got upset seeing the Icelandic sheepdog in the show for the first time. It was too darned big! So I ran to get my dog breed encyclopedias and all of them said they should be 12-16 inches. Then I checked the new and un-improved AKC standard and they want 16.5-18 inches! Blasphemy! And its not like I even looked up the icelandic sheepdog before the show so I'd be prepared. I had no interest in the breed. But I remember all about them because I read every new dog breed book I get from cover to cover.
